The clinton county historical society was established in 1921, and incorporated in 1976. At first, artifacts were stored in one room of the courthouse attic, and then in the basement. In june of 1980, the historical museum was established and given a permanent home in three rooms of “old stoney.

Clinton county officially came into existence on march 1, 1830, and was named in honor of dewitt clinton, the seventh governor of new york state and architect of the erie canal, which opened up the upper midwest to settlement.

The county assessor is an elected official who may serve unlimited 4 year terms. The primary duties of the assessor are to certify assessed values to the auditor, serve as secretary of the county property tax board of appeals, and equalize assessments.
